Intelligent 3D online virtual conferencing system with natural human-computer interaction
In this paper, we propose an intelligent 3D online virtual conferencing system with a natural human-computer interactive mechanism. With 4 degree-of-freedom of gesture commands as the human-computer interface of the system, participants can change their positions and orientations in a virtual space to interact with others and observe the environment. A 3D tracking-based gesture recognition method with high accuracy and a 3D scene construction technique are adopted in the proposed system. With the real 3D interactive experience provided, the system enables people around the world to communicate and cooperate with each other easier and more efficient than ever before.
